May 2025 - Apr 2026Trowbridge Road area has the 13th highest crime rate of 115 local areas in Frome East , and the 179th highest crime rate of 1,847 local areas in Somerset .
This postcode sits in a local crime hotspot. Overall crime levels here are significantly higher than in the surrounding streets and the wider area.
The overall crime rate in the area around Trowbridge Road (BA11 6SF) in the last 12 months was 208.8 per 1,000 residents and was 143.5% higher than the Frome East average (85.7 per 1,000 residents). In the last 12 months, this area’s most reported crimes were Violence and sexual offences with 13 offences recorded. The least common crime was Burglary with 1 case , up 100.0% compared to 2025. The fastest-growing crime category was Anti-social behaviour ( 200.0% YoY). The sharpest decline was Vehicle crime ( -50.0% YoY).
Violent crimes totalled 19 (≈ 104.4 per 1,000 residents). Year-over-year these were rising ( 46.2% ). Over the last decade, overall crime has rising ( 104.8% comparing early vs recent averages) .
In the area around Trowbridge Road (BA11 6SF), the main crime hotspot is near Petrol Station. Police recorded 27 crimes here, including 12 violent or public-order offences. All these locations are within roughly 0.3 miles.
